Dart SDK for Walrus decentralized blob storage with caching, streaming, and authentication.

class WalrusManager {
WalrusManager()
: client = WalrusClient(
publisherBaseUrl: Uri.parse(
'https://walrus-testnet-publisher.starduststaking.com', //this endpoint was changed to https to avoid 301 redirects
),
aggregatorBaseUrl: Uri.parse('https://agg.test.walrus.eosusa.io'),
timeout: const Duration(seconds: 30),
cacheMaxSize: 100,
useSecureConnection: false, // testnet certs are currently untrusted
// logLevel: WalrusLogLevel.basic,
);
final WalrusClient client;
Future<void> dispose() async {
await client.close();
}
}
